Several Chiefs starters placed on season-ending injured reserveKANSAS CITY, Mo. (KCTV) – Several key contributors for the Kansas City Chiefs have been placed on season-ending injured reserve.

The Chiefs announced Wednesday that cornerbacks Trent McDuffie and Jaylen Watson and wide receivers Rashee Rice and Tyquan Thornton each were placed on injured reserve.

Rice and Thornton suffered concussions in Kansas City’s Week 15 loss to the Los Angeles Chargers, and neither played against the Tennessee Titans in Sunday’s 26-9 loss.

It’s the second year in a row Rice has ended the year on injured reserve, after he suffered a significant knee injury that derailed his 2024 season.

McDuffie has missed multiple games after hyperextending his knee in the first quarter of Kansas City’s Week 14 loss to the Houston Texans. Watson has dealt with a hamstring injury in recent weeks.

In corresponding moves, the Chiefs signed defensive end Ethan Downs, cornerback Melvin Smith and defensive end Tyreke Smith to active roster contracts from the practice squad.

Cornerback Nazeeh Johnson has also been activated from injured reserve. Johnson has yet to play a game this season.
